While few projects are as large in scope as this two-story outdoor living space and pool, the project does perfectly illustrate how important it is to hire a contractor who can manage all the teams necessary for completing your perfect space.
This Desoto stunner includes two-story stone beams, a two-sided stone fire space, a seating area, a cooking area and a pool. To make sure everything is completed to perfection, Schloegel designers and craftsman are working with structural engineers, timber-smiths, concrete and foundation subcontractors, masonry subcontractors and a pool company.
Of course, most projects don’t require a team this large. It is common, however, to have multiple subcontractors who specialize in certain services or projects working on the same renovation.
Having multiple people from different companies on one project is likely to overwhelm many general contractors who don’t have proven management standards and procedures in place.
